AI Summary

  • Requests the Department of Transportation or Oahu Metropolitan Planning Organization to work with the City and County of Honolulu's Department of Transportation Services to develop a traffic mitigation plan for the Aiea-Red Hill-Moanalua-Salt Lake area.

  • Plan must address current congestion and additional future congestion expected after completion of the Moanalua Hillside Development, which would add 500-1,000 new vehicles to the area.

  • Requires a joint report including projected costs and implementation timeline to be submitted to the Legislature no later than twenty days before the 2017 Regular Session convenes.

  • Cites 2015 data showing Honolulu as the third most congested U.S. city with 32% congestion level and notes major bottlenecks including the Halawa Interchange and H-3 merge at Ala Kapuna Street experiencing significant delays.
